Razer Phone 2

Razer certainly knows what it’s doing when it involves gaming. And it’s followed up the impressive Razer Phone with the even more impressive Razer Phone 2.

The screen is brighter, the speakers are louder. And there is more power under the hood to push those frame rates on the foremost demanding games that the Android platform has got to offer.

With a resolution of 1,440 x 2,560 pixels, the 5.7-inch display is super-sharp at 513 pixels-per-inch. And with a 120Hz refresh rate, you should not miss any of the actions.

Plus, an improved cooling system inside the chassis means the Snapdragon 845 processor. And 8GB of RAM can really get to operate without overheating becoming an issue on the phone.

ASUS ROG Phone 3

There’s no doubt that the Asus ROG laptops are a number of the best in the business for gamers. And also, similarly branded smartphones do the business also.

The third version of the Republic of Gamers handset brings with it a variety of improvements, including 5G and a far better camera.

This phone is completely stacked with power. Not only does it come with the absolute best CPU for Android phones,

You’ll also get it fitted with a whopping 16GB of RAM, which may be a crazy amount. You can probably run three games side by side on this without noticing any kind of slowdown.

There’s a lot more to love also, including customizable buttons on the side of the Asus ROG Phone 3. And a special gaming mode in the software to be sure you’re always getting maximum performance.

The 6.59-inch display may be a real highlight too, running at a refresh rate of 144Hz to be sure that the action on screen always looks super-smooth.

Xiaomi Black Shark 3

The latest handset in Xiaomi’s Black Shark gaming line is simply as impressive as the first two. It’s full of power and functionality. Also, a number of features are aimed to appeal to people wanting a superior portable gaming experience.

It’s hard to select a fault in anything the Black Shark 3 offers from a gaming perspective. And there’s the pro version too if you would like a much bigger screen.

It’s not a budget phone, but at a starting price of a bit over £500 within the UK. And it is very affordable considering what you get for your money. Including a top-end Snapdragon 865 processor and a better cooling system.

The 4720 mAh battery gives you lots of time between charges also, even when there are extended gaming sessions involved.
